I. The Impact of Website Speed on User Experience

  1. First Impressions: Website speed is crucial for making a positive first impression on users. Slow-loading websites can deter visitors and lead to high bounce rates, reducing the chances of conversions.
  2. User Expectations: Users have come to expect fast-loading websites, and any delay can result in frustration and a negative perception of your brand.
  3. User Engagement: Fast websites encourage users to stay longer, explore more pages, and engage with your content, leading to increased time on site and improved conversion rates.

II. Website Speed and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

  1. Google Ranking Factor: Website speed is a ranking factor in Google’s search algorithm. Faster websites have a higher chance of ranking well in search engine results pages (SERPs).
  2. Crawlability: Search engine bots have limited time to crawl your website. A slow site can hinder the crawling process, leading to incomplete indexing and reduced visibility in search results.
  3. Mobile-First Indexing: With the increasing dominance of mobile devices, website speed is even more crucial. Google’s mobile-first indexing prioritizes fast-loading mobile websites in search rankings.

V. Strategies for Optimizing Website Speed

  1. Minimize File Sizes: Compress images, minify CSS and JavaScript files, and optimize code to reduce file sizes and improve load times.
  2. Use a Content Delivery Network (CDN): A CDN distributes your website’s content across multiple servers, reducing the distance between users and your website’s server, resulting in faster loading times.
  3. Browser Caching: Enable browser caching to store static files on users’ devices, allowing subsequent visits to load faster.
  4. Optimize Hosting: Choose a reliable and fast hosting provider that can handle your website’s traffic and optimize server configurations.
  5. Remove Unnecessary Plugins and Scripts: Evaluate your website’s plugins and scripts and remove any that are unnecessary or slowing down your site.
